I decided to just make a screen for my HT and got all the materials for $70. I got the screen material off a seller on bay for $60 delivered and it was here in two days from purchase! The material is just as described and first rate!
http://cgi.ebay.com/ws/eBayISAPI.dll?ViewItem&ssPageName=STRK:MEWNX:IT&item=250434779942
I got the wood at good old home depot 4-2"x2"x8' and 2-1"x2"x8' for $8. I had some glue, screws and staples already. I made some 6" gussets for the corners out of 3/4" MDF I had lying around and got to work.

Next I stapled the screen material to the to the frame. if you have access to a pneumatic or electric stapler I would suggest it. This might take some minor adjustments along the way so don't get to far ahead of yourself. I started in the corners and worked my way around going in between each staple until I filled in the gaps.
Now the result is a screen with no creases wrinkles any inperfections of any kind.
